In today’s ever-changing job market, companies are constantly evolving and adapting to stay competitive Unfortunately, this can sometimes result in downsizing or restructuring, leading to the need for outplacement services Outplacement is a process that helps employees transition to new careers after being laid off or made redundant It provides support in the form of career coaching, resume writing, job search assistance, and more This article will explore the benefits of outplacement for both employers and employees, as well as the key components of a successful outplacement program.
For Employers:
Outplacement services can be a valuable tool for employers who are faced with the difficult task of letting employees go By providing outplacement assistance, employers can demonstrate their commitment to supporting their employees during a challenging time This can help maintain a positive employer brand and preserve relationships with former employees, as well as boost morale among remaining staff members.
Additionally, outplacement services can help to reduce the negative impact of layoffs on productivity and employee engagement When employees are provided with support in finding new employment opportunities, they are more likely to leave on good terms and speak positively about their former employer This can help maintain a positive company culture and reputation, even in the face of difficult decisions.
For Employees:
For employees who have been laid off, outplacement services can be a lifeline during a time of uncertainty and transition Outplacement provides access to career experts who can help employees navigate the job market, update their resumes, and prepare for interviews This support can be invaluable in helping employees find new opportunities quickly and smoothly transition to a new role.
Outplacement services can also provide emotional support during a time of upheaval Losing a job can be a stressful and emotional experience, and having a support system in place can make a significant difference in how employees cope with the transition By providing outplacement support, employers can help employees feel valued and respected, even as they are facing job loss.
Key Components of a Successful Outplacement Program:

Career Coaching: One of the most important components of outplacement is career coaching Career coaches can help employees identify their strengths, weaknesses, and career goals, as well as develop a personalized job search strategy This can help employees make informed decisions about their future and find new opportunities that align with their skills and interests.
2 Resume Writing: A strong resume is essential for securing interviews and landing a job Outplacement services often provide resume writing assistance to help employees showcase their skills and experience effectively This can make a significant difference in how a candidate is perceived by potential employers and increase their chances of success in the job market.
3 Job Search Assistance: Outplacement services can also provide job search assistance to help employees identify job opportunities, submit applications, and prepare for interviews This support can help employees navigate the job market more effectively and find new opportunities that match their skills and experience.
